AFS法快速测定茶叶中Hg、As和Se的方法研究

摘    要:目的]为AFS法测定茶叶微量元素的推广与应用提供理论依据。方法]准确称取研磨碎的各种茶叶粉末1.00 g,用10 ml混合酸(HNO3-HClO4)预处理,用电热板加热消解和烘箱加热消解两种不同的方法消解茶叶,用连续流动进样-氢化物发生原子吸收荧光光谱法(AFS)同时测定茶叶中有害元素As、Hg和有益元素Se。并对消解温度、消解试剂用量、消解程序设计、消解时间等消解条件进行优化。结果]在测试样品中添加适量的Hg、As和Se标准溶液,按样品测定的全过程进行测定时,As的回收率为113.3%,Hg的回收率为115.0%,Se的回收率为92.5%。结论]AFS法可满足同时测定茶叶中Hg、AsS、e等多种微量元素的需要,且测定的精密度与准确度都较高,快捷简便,有助于推广。

Research on the AFS Method Rapidly Detecting Mercury, Arsenic and Selenium in the Tea

Abstract:Objective] The study was to provide theoretical basis for the popularization and application of the AFS method to rapidly determine the trace element in the tea.Method] 1.00 g mashed powder of some kinds of teas was accurately taken,and they were pretreatment with 10 ml mixed acid(HNO3-HClO4),the teas were digested with 2 different digestion methods of electric hot plate heating and oven-heating,the harmful elements arsenic and mercury,and the beneficial elements selenium were detected at the same time with the method of continual flow injection-hydride generation atomic absorption fluorescence spectroscopy(AFS).The dispel conditions of digestion temperature,digestion reagent dosage,digestion programming and digestion time etc.1 were optimized.Result] The proper amount of standard solution of mercury,arsenic and selenium were added in test sample,and they were detected according to the whole process of sample determination.The recovery of arsenic was 113.3%,the recovery of mercury was 115.0%,and the recovery of selenium was 92.5%.Conclusion] The method of AFS could meet the needs of detecting many kinds of trace element such as mercury,arsenic and selenium etc.in the tea,and it had higher the detecting precision and detecting accuracy. The method was rapid,simple and helpful to be generalized.
